Warner Chappell Music, the global music publishing company of Warner Music Group, is home to a wide array of legendary songwriters and a rich catalog of contemporary hits and influential standard. With offices in more than 40 countries, Warner Chappell Music provides a deep expertise across a range of creative services and the most innovative opportunities for songwriters and copyright holders. With a history dating back more than 200 years, Warner Chappell currently publishes and administers music from Lizzo, Lil Jon, Smashing Pumpkins, Justin Tranter, George Michael, Cranberries, Lil Wayne, Rae Sremmurd, Kacey Musgraves, Chris Stapleton, Eric Clapton, FUN, Gamble & Huff, Green Day, Katy Perry, Led Zeppelin, Annapurna, Madonna, Miramax Films, Muse, Radiohead, Stephen Sondheim, Cole Porter, among many others.

The Synchronization department represents music publishing rights and offers clients a comprehensive licensing service. They work to serve songwriters by strategically developing new opportunities in Film, TV, Advertising, Video Games and other audio/visual media. Here you'll get to:
• Work with all members of the clearance and licensing teams depending on the stage of project.
• Enter synchronization quotes into digital system.
• Perform research duties of the Company's rights to songs and copyright provisions.
• Manage and obtain approvals, when necessary, and provide quotes for synchronization requests including, but not limited to television, live-streaming concerts, documentaries, student films, etc.
• Coordinate and confer with Company's internal departments as well as outside parties including but not limited to co-publishers, copyright owners, composers, their manager and/or lawyers, regarding clearance, ownership, and financial procedures and fees.
• Manage and be responsible for handling both telephone and correspondence from parties requesting fee quotations and license requests for the use of Company products contained in the catalogue.
• Maintain records such as logs, files, and deals.
• Handle and safeguard confidential and proprietary information.

With its broad and diverse roster of new stars and legendary artists, Warner Music Group is home to a collection of the best-known record labels in the music industry including Asylum, Atlantic, East West, Elektra, FFRR, Fueled by Ramen, Nonesuch, Parlophone, Rhino, Roadrunner, Sire, Warner Records, Warner Classics and Warner Chappell Music, one of the world's leading music publishers with a catalogue of more than one million copyrights worldwide.

For more than four decades, WMG has been an industry-leading force in providing a world-class array of services designed to help artists and labels grow their careers and their businesses. Artist & Label Services is the umbrella for WEA (Warner-Elektra-Atlantic) – the pioneering WEA distribution and marketing network – and Alternative Distribution Alliance (ADA) – the ground-breaking global distribution company for independent artists and labels.
